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a folded mobile phone that saves the power consumption so as to prevent a waiting time and a speech time from being decreased. SOLUTION: The mobile phone provided with a rear LCD whose display face is placed on a rear side of an enclosure and a main LCD whose display face is placed on a mated face of the enclosure is characterized by that the mobile phone is provided with a detection means that transmits a prescribed signal when detecting a prescribed shape and with a control section that automatically controls switching of power supplied to the rear LCD and the main LCD by receiving the signal sent from the detection means.

The power supply circuit section 10 supplies power from a battery to the rear LCD 3 and the main LCD 8 at a constant voltage.
Power is supplied to the rear LCD 3 from the power supply circuit unit 10 via the SW 12. Power is supplied to the main LCD 8 from the power supply circuit unit 10 via the SW 13. The control circuit unit 9 automatically controls ON / OFF switching of the SW 12 and the SW 13 by receiving the constant state signal 11 from the detection unit. As a result, the power of the rear LCD 3 and the power of the main LCD 8 are switch-controlled. The detection signal 11 is a signal which is transmitted to the control circuit when a certain state of the mobile phone is detected by the detecting means. The detection means includes an open / close detection means 15 for detecting the open / closed state of the housing, a press detection means 16 for detecting press of a side button, and an incoming / call detection means 17 for detecting an incoming signal or a call signal.
